1926: Actor Richard Crenna, best known for his roles in movies such as "The Sand Pebbles," "Body Heat" and the first three "Rambo" movies, is born in Los Angeles, Calif. He also would appear in the TV series "Our Miss Brooks" and "The Real McCoys."
